MEMBERS OF THE
TOWNSHIP COMMITTEE:
Republican:
DANIEL MULLIGAN
Total: 143
R-WRITE-IN CANDIDATE:
ARTHUR HASSELBACH
Total: 47
Democrat:
GLENN R. JOHNSON
Total:90
D-WRITE-IN CANDIDATE:
JOHN RITTER
Total: 4 (Six needed to qualify)
The absentee count from the County is still not in so a few more votes should still be added. |
